Albany Medical vs. SUNY Upstate

Both Albany Medical College and Upstate Medical University are 4 years schools located in New York. The following statements compare Albany Medical College and Upstate Medical University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Albany Medical's tuition ($28,695) is more expensive than SUNY Upstate ($19,878).
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 8 to 1.
  • SUNY Upstate (1,341 students) is larger than Albany Medical (814 students) with more enrolled students.
